What Is IFSC Code and Why Is It Important?
IFSC stands for Indian Financial System Code, an 11-character alphanumeric code provided by the Reserve Bank of India. Every bank branch, including Bank Of Baroda located in Ranchi, Jamshedpur, Jharkhand, is provided with a unique IFSC like BARB0DBRANC to ensure that online payments reach the right destination.
The IFSC Code is important because:
- It uniquely identifies the Bank Of Baroda branch in Jamshedpur.
- It helps NEFT, RTGS, and IMPS systems route the transfer securely.
- It avoids any errors or confusions between multiple branches of the same bank across different places like Jamshedpur and Ranchi.
- It reduces errors in fund transfers and improves accuracy.
- It allows sender banks to validate and confirm branch details before processing payments.

Format of the IFSC Code BARB0DBRANC
The format of the IFSC Code for banks, including Bank Of Baroda, has an 11-character structure:
AAAA0CCCCCC
Here's the breakdown:
- First 4 characters (AAAA): Show the bank code. For Bank Of Baroda, these letters represent the bank's short name.
- 5th character: Is always zero and is kept for future use.
-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): Represent the specific branch code assigned to branches such as Ranchi in Jamshedpur.
For example, the IFSC Code BARB0DBRANC of Bank Of Baroda for the Ranchi branch includes these elements, identifying the bank and the branch location in Jamshedpur and Jharkhand correctly.
